PURPOSE: Working in conditions with daily exposure to organic solvents for many years can result in a disease known as chronic solvent-induced encephalopathy (CSE). The aims for this study were to describe the neuropsychological course of CSE after first diagnosis and to detect prognostic factors for neuropsychological impairment after diagnosis. METHODS: This prospective study follows a Dutch cohort of CSE patients who were first diagnosed between 2001 and 2011 and underwent a second neuropsychological assessment 1.5-2 years later. Cognitive subdomains were assessed and an overall cognitive impairment score was calculated. Paired t tests and multivariate linear regression analyses were performed to describe the neuropsychological course and to obtain prognostic factors for the neuropsychological functioning at follow-up. RESULTS: There was a significant improvement on neuropsychological subdomains at follow-up, with effect sizes between small and medium (Cohen's d 0.27-0.54) and a significant overall improvement of neuropsychological impairment with a medium effect size (Cohen's d 0.56). Prognostic variables for more neuropsychological impairment at follow-up were a higher level of neuropsychological impairment at diagnosis and having a comorbid diagnosis of a psychiatric disorder at diagnosis. CONCLUSIONS: Results are in line with previous research on the course of CSE, stating that CSE is a non-progressive disease after cessation of exposure. However, during follow-up the percentage patients with permanent work disability pension increased from 14 to 37%. Preventive action is needed in countries where exposure to organic solvents is still high to prevent new cases of CSE.

INTRODUCTION: The use of performance validity tests (PVTs) in a neuropsychological assessment to determine indications of invalid performance has been a common practice for over a decade. Most PVTs are memory-based; therefore, the Groningen Effort Test (GET), a non-memory-based PVT, has been developed. OBJECTIVES: This study aimed to validate the GET in patients with suspected chronic solvent-induced encephalopathy (CSE) using the criterion standard of 2PVTs. A second goal was to determine diagnostic accuracy for GET. METHOD: Sixty patients with suspected CSE referred for NPA were included. The GET was compared to the criterion standard of 2PVTs based on the Test of Memory Malingering and the Amsterdam Short Term Memory Test. RESULTS: The frequency of invalid performance using the GET was significantly higher compared to the criterion of 2PVTs (51.7% vs. 20.0% respectively; p < 0.001). For the GET index, the sensitivity was 75% and the specificity was 54%, with a Youden's Index of 27. CONCLUSION: The GET showed significantly more invalid performance compared to the 2PVTs criterion suggesting a high number of false positives. The general accepted minimum norm of specificity for PVTs of >90% was not met. Therefore, the GET is of limited use in clinical practice with suspected CSE patients.

Exposure to different toxic substances can have acute and chronic neurological and neuropsychiatric health effects on humans. Patients often report impaired concentration and memory, irritability, fatigue, instability of affect and difficulties in impulse control. The diagnostic process for neurotoxic diseases is complex and relies heavily on the exclusion of differential diagnosis and substantiating the cognitive complaints by neuropsychological assessment. Diagnostic evaluations have the purpose to help the patient by finding an explanation for the symptoms to guide treatment strategy or prevent further deterioration. But what if the diagnostic process in itself leads to problems that can be quite persistent and difficult to manage? The iatrogenic, or sick-making, side effects of the diagnostic process are the main focus of this case study.
